After Decades, Vacant Lot Finally Filled by Rowhome, at 55-35 Metropolitan Avenue, on Ridgewood/Maspeth Border

City blocks on the fringes between Queens and Brooklyn tend to be densely built out with low-rise, pre-war housing stock, leaving few empty lots for ground-up development. One such lot at 55-35 Metropolitan Avenue, which separates the neighborhoods of Ridgewood to the south and Maspeth to the north, has sat empty for more than half a century. The new rowhouse, developed by Shaoyun Chen, stands three stories tall, its plain cornice rising slightly above its neighbors. Permits list two residential units taking up 2,396 square feet of the 5,643-square-foot structure. A 1,623-square-foot retail space is located at the lower floor. Though the retail space would be the only one of its kind on the wholly-residential block, it is not out of place, given that most buildings on the other side of the street have ground level retail, as well. The building occupies 60 percent of its site, leaving space for a 35-foot yard in the rear.

Developer Plans Cantilevering 33-Story Condominium Tower at 1361-1363 First Avenue, Upper East Side

CW Realty is planning to develop a 33-story condominium tower at 1361-1363 First Avenue, located on the corner of East 73rd Street on the Upper East Side. The project is expected to measure roughly 120,000 square feet and is being designed by HTO Architects, the New York Post reported. The number of planned apartments wasn’t disclosed, and it’s unclear whether there will be commercial space included. The new building will cantilever over the adjacent four-story tenement at 1365 First Avenue. CW Realty acquired the four-story mixed-use building at 1361 First Avenue earlier this year for $9.4 million and is in contract to purchase the four-story tenement at 1363 First Avenue. The latter sale is expected to close next year, and existing commercial and residential tenants in both properties are already in the process of relocating. The developer will also transfer air rights to the assemblage from other properties on the block. Demolition permits haven’t yet been filed.
